The HR & Benefits Administration Specialist for Beckman Coulter Diagnostics is responsible for providing comprehensive HR support to employees, managers and the HR team across all aspects of the Employee Lifecycle with a focus on employee benefit & absence management. This is a 12 month contract, part-time position working 22 hours per week (three days to include a Wednesday) on-site at our offices located in Little Chalfont. You will work closely with our HRBP reporting to the Senior Manager Human Resources. Job Responsibilities: Manage Employee Benefits: Oversee all elements related to employee benefits, ensuring seamless communication with staff about available options and enhancements. Facilitate the benefit election process, guiding employees in selecting and understanding their coverage options. Provide HR Support: Serve as the initial point of contact for employees with HR-related inquiries, offering clear guidance and support on various issues, such as employment policies. Assist in the onboarding and orientation of new hires, ensuring they are informed about organizational policies and included within team operations adequately. Ensure Accurate HR System Updates: Maintain HR systems with regular updates, ensuring information recorded is accurate, comprehensive, and up to date. Enhance workflows and documentation, implementing best practices for information management that support operational efficiency. Generate reports and analyses from HR systems, focusing particularly on absence management, to provide insights that aid in strategic planning and decision-making. Work closely with IT or system vendors to troubleshoot issues and optimize the performance and functionality of HR platforms. The essential requirements of the job include: Multiple years of previous experience working in an HR function within a fast-paced, matrix organisation Strong HRIS experience (ideally Workday) and confident using Microsoft Excel for analysing employee data sets Ability to prioritise workload, organised and structured with high level attention to detail. A self starter with effective communication skills at all levels and cross culturally It would be a plus if you also possess previous experience in: Using Workday or ADP systems Managing employee absence in line with HR policy and legal requirements Join our winning team today.
